+diff --git a/crypto/async/arch/async_posix.h b/crypto/async/arch/async_posix.h
+index 873c0316dd..db42a01880 100644
+--- a/crypto/async/arch/async_posix.h
++++ b/crypto/async/arch/async_posix.h
+@@ -25,17 +25,33 @@
+ # define ASYNC_POSIX
+ # define ASYNC_ARCH
+
++# ifdef __CET__
++/*
++ * When Intel CET is enabled, makecontext will create a different
++ * shadow stack for each context. async_fibre_swapcontext cannot
++ * use _longjmp. It must call swapcontext to swap shadow stack as
++ * well as normal stack.
++ */
++# define USE_SWAPCONTEXT
++# endif
+ # include <ucontext.h>
+-# include <setjmp.h>
++# ifndef USE_SWAPCONTEXT
++# include <setjmp.h>
++# endif
+
+ typedef struct async_fibre_st {
+ ucontext_t fibre;
++# ifndef USE_SWAPCONTEXT
+ jmp_buf env;
+ int env_init;
++# endif
+ } async_fibre;
+
+ static ossl_inline int async_fibre_swapcontext(async_fibre *o, async_fibre *n, int r)
+ {
++# ifdef USE_SWAPCONTEXT
++ swapcontext(&o->fibre, &n->fibre);
++# else
+ o->env_init = 1;
+
+ if (!r || !_setjmp(o->env)) {
+@@ -44,6 +60,7 @@ static ossl_inline int async_fibre_swapcontext(async_fibre *o, async_fibre *n, i
+ else
+ setcontext(&n->fibre);
+ }
++# endif
+
+ return 1;
+ }

+diff --git a/crypto/perlasm/x86_64-xlate.pl b/crypto/perlasm/x86_64-xlate.pl
+index 29a0eacfd5..7ffba4c450 100755
+--- a/crypto/perlasm/x86_64-xlate.pl
++++ b/crypto/perlasm/x86_64-xlate.pl
+@@ -101,6 +101,33 @@ elsif (!$gas)
+ $decor="\$L\$";
+ }
+
++my $cet_property;
++if ($flavour =~ /elf/) {
++ # Always generate .note.gnu.property section for ELF outputs to
++ # mark Intel CET support since all input files must be marked
++ # with Intel CET support in order for linker to mark output with
++ # Intel CET support.
++ my $p2align=3; $p2align=2 if ($flavour eq "elf32");
++ $cet_property = <<_____;
++ .section ".note.gnu.property", "a"
++ .p2align $p2align
++ .long 1f - 0f
++ .long 4f - 1f
++ .long 5
++0:
++ .asciz "GNU"
++1:
++ .p2align $p2align
++ .long 0xc0000002
++ .long 3f - 2f
++2:
++ .long 3
++3:
++ .p2align $p2align
++4:
++_____
++}
++
+ my $current_segment;
+ my $current_function;
+ my %globals;
+@@ -1213,6 +1240,7 @@ while(defined(my $line=<>)) {
+ print $line,"\n";
+ }
+
++print "$cet_property" if ($cet_property);
+ print "\n$current_segment\tENDS\n" if ($current_segment && $masm);
+ print "END\n" if ($masm);
+
